Quick answerFrom October 20, 2012, all scheduled commercial banks and AIFIs must submit AML/CFT reports exclusively via the FINnet gateway in XML format. CD-based submissions will be rejected after this date. Ensure your systems are ready for the new XML reporting format.

What changed

FIU-IND has set October 20, 2012 as the go-live date for the FINnet gateway, replacing the earlier test mode. After this date, reports submitted on CD will no longer be accepted as valid. Banks must now use only the FINnet gateway for uploading reports in the new XML format.

What it means for you

Banks and AIFIs must complete the transition from CD-based to online XML reporting by October 20, 2012. Non-compliance will result in reports being treated as invalid by FIU-IND, potentially leading to regulatory scrutiny. This move streamlines reporting but requires immediate IT and operational adjustments.

Who it affects

All Scheduled Commercial Banks (excluding RRBs), Local Area Banks, All India Financial Institutions (AIFIs), Principal Officers responsible for AML/CFT reporting

What happens if we submit a CD report after October 20, 2012?

FIU-IND will not treat it as a valid submission. Only reports uploaded via the FINnet gateway in XML format will be accepted.

Is there a help desk for FINnet gateway issues?

Yes, contact FIU-IND help desk at 011-24109792/93 or via email for any clarifications or assistance.

Do we need to acknowledge this circular?

Yes, your Principal Officer must acknowledge receipt of this circular to confirm compliance.
